Description
A delightful blend of sweet honey and spicy Sriracha making these Brussels sprouts a perfect side dish for any occasion.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b Brussels sprouts
- 2 tablespoons honey
- 1 tablespoon Sriracha sauce
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- Salt, to taste
- Pepper, to taste
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Trim and halve the Brussels sprouts, ensuring a uniform size for even roasting.
- Combine the Brussels sprouts with olive oil, salt, and pepper in a mixing bowl, ensuring they are all evenly coated.
- Spread the Brussels sprouts on a baking sheet and roast for about 20-25 minutes until golden brown and crispy.
- Mix together the honey and Sriracha in a small bowl until well combined.
- Drizzle the honey-Sriracha sauce over the roasted Brussels sprouts and toss to coat thoroughly.
- Serve warm as a delightful side dish.
Notes
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. Reheat in the oven to restore their crispy texture.
